I was curious what the crowd sizes (during the normal park hours) are like when there is MVMCP that evening . I’m Not going to be purchasing tickets for the party and am trying to figure out if it’s worth going to the Magic Kingdom on days with parties that evening. Are the crowds heavier on days with party? Or possibly really low crowds in the morning and then heavier at 4pm when people with MVMCP tickets can start entering? I’d like to start our vacation at MK, but since it’s a party night, I wasn’t sure if I’d be better off going to a different park that day.

Our experience doing MK on party days (Christmas or Halloween) has been that crowds are lower during the morning and early afternoon compared to non party days... Now, that does not mean they are empty, but we have found them definitely less crowded.

Concur. We thought the crowd was light until close to 5:00 PM when the MVMCP folks started to pile in.

I agree with the others. And the crowds are high on non-party days when people are trying to stay late at the MK without having to buy a party ticket.
